Dotabod is a livestream enhancement tool for Dota 2 Twitch streamers, described by the official site as an open-source toolkit. It uses the Dota 2 Gamestate Integration API to access real-time match data and improve stream interaction through OBS browser-source overlays, a Twitch chat bot, channel point predictions, and related features.
The product is tightly focused on the Dota 2 streaming scenario. It can automatically create and close Twitch predictions, allowing viewers to use channel points to predict match outcomes. It provides overlays for MMR, win/loss records, rank, progress toward the next rank, and more. It also supports Roshan/Aegis timers, in-game event announcements, suspected smurf detection, and player medal displays. Its anti-stream-sniping features are also fairly comprehensive for streamers, including automatic minimap blocking, hero-pick blocking, XL minimap support, and adjustable blocking strength. Pro also includes integrations such as automatic OBS setup/scene switching, 7TV, and Spotify/YouTube song display.
The Free plan costs $0 and requires no credit card. It covers core overlays, MMR tracking, basic chat commands, basic minimap blocking, and basic game events. Pro costs $6/month, $57/year, or a one-time payment of $99, with a 14-day trial. It adds automatic predictions, advanced overlays, Pro commands, a Roshan timer, Manager access, and beta features. Payment methods include bank cards, PayPal, and Crypto, with the terms listing Visa, Mastercard, American Express, and Discover.
Its main strength is a very clear vertical focus: many features directly address pain points for Dota 2 streamers, such as stream-sniping protection, automatic predictions, and real-time data-driven interaction. The free version is enough to get started, and Pro is also relatively inexpensive. The downside is that its use case is narrow: it is largely unsuitable for non-Dota 2 or non-Twitch scenarios. The available materials also do not disclose enterprise-grade security certifications, SLA, audit logs, data residency, or whether it offers an open API, Webhooks, or self-hosting.
Dotabod is suitable for Dota 2 Twitch streamers who want to improve viewer retention and engagement, especially those who need automated predictions, chat commands, and livestream overlays. Access from mainland China is not disclosed in the available materials, and because it depends on overseas services such as Twitch, PayPal, and international cards, actual network access and payment may be limited. If you do not need Dota 2-specific functionality, alternatives include StreamElements, Nightbot, Moobot, Fossabot, Streamlabs, or general-purpose OBS plugins.
